Unequal Tire Pressure

Different pressure levels between the left and right tires are among the most frequent causes of drifting. A tire with lower pressure creates greater rolling resistance, which can cause the vehicle to pull toward that side.
Check tire pressure regularly, especially before long trips and after significant temperature changes. Keeping all tires inflated to the recommended pressure supports balanced handling and better steering response.

Uneven Tire Wear

Tire tread is responsible for maintaining grip and stability. When one side of the vehicle has more worn tread than the other, traction becomes uneven and straight-line driving may be affected.
Rotate the tires at the recommended intervals to promote even wear and extend tire life.

Worn Suspension Parts

The suspension keeps the vehicle balanced and helps maintain stable contact with the road. Over time, shock absorbers, bushings, and steering joints can wear and allow excessive movement.
Common signs include reduced stability, unusual noises on uneven roads, and a tendency for the vehicle to wander.

Wheel Bearing Wear

Wheel bearings help the wheels rotate smoothly. If a bearing becomes worn, one wheel may create more resistance than the other, leading to a subtle pull while driving.
A humming or growling sound that becomes louder with speed is a common warning sign.

Incorrect Wheel Alignment

Wheel alignment determines the direction and angle of each wheel. Hitting rough roads, potholes, or curbs can gradually move these settings out of specification.
Poor alignment can cause drifting, uneven tire wear, and reduced steering accuracy. Periodic alignment checks help maintain straight and predictable handling.

Off-Center Steering Wheel

If the steering wheel is not centered while the vehicle is traveling straight, the steering or alignment system may need adjustment.
This condition often appears after alignment changes or wear in steering components and should be inspected to restore proper steering position.

Uneven Braking Force

A vehicle that pulls to one side during braking may have an imbalance in braking force. Sticking brake calipers or restricted brake components can create this effect.
Any noticeable pull while braking should be inspected promptly to maintain safe and consistent braking performance.
